It was reported previously that proteolytic enzyme-treated M red cells lost their reactivity completely with only anti-M IgG antibody.In this paper, M red cells treated with trypsin for 45 min or 3 hr were used to prepare group-specific anti-M IgG and -N IgG antibodies as an adsorbent.It was revealed that M red cells treated for 3 hr could adsorb anti-N antibody in anti-M IgG fraction obtained from crude anti-M serum by DEAEcellulose column chromatography.The potency of the red cells to adsorb anti-N IgG antibody was similar to that of normal N red cells. Anti-N IgG antibody was prepared by heat-eluting trypsin-treated M red cells sensitized with anti-N fraction.However, the experiments with M red cells treated for 45 min showed unsatisfactory results.It was due to the red cells which could still react with high-titered anti-M IgG antibody but not sufficiently with anti-N IgG antibody.-MN blood groups; IgG; proteolytic enzymeThe MN blood grouping has been usually performed with rabbit anti-M and -N sera in which non-specific agglutinins were adsorbed by the red cells lacking the respective agglutinogens. Although anti-M and -N agglutinins from human, animals other than rabbit and plant seed are practically used, it has been pointed out that these agglutinins still contain some non-specific agglutinins (Race and Sanger 1968). In the previous paper (Sagisaka et al. 1972a), it was revealed that proteolytic enzyme-treated M red cells lost their reactivity completely with anti-M IgG antibody but became agglutinable with each of anti-M IgA and IgM antibodies and anti-N IgG, IgA and IgM antibodies. These findings suggested that trypsintreated M red cells could adsorb non-specific agglutinins in anti-M IgG and anti-N IgG fractions prepared from crude anti-M and -N sera by DEAE-cellulose column chromatography.In this paper, attempts to specify anti-M IgG fraction by adsorption and anti-N IgG fraction by adsorption-elution method using M red cells treated sufficiently with trypsin were described.
